Dos Maria’s Basketball Team Falls to Suga Show in Overtime


(Laredo, Texas)-South Laredo’s Suga Show Basketball Team gets by Dos Marias Basketball Team with a 61-50 win in overtime in their Division A home opener last night played at the Haynes Recreational Center. Suga Show took an early lead in the first half only to see it evaporate halfway thru the half against a tough Dos Marias team that played great throughout the night on both ends of the court.


Suga Show was forced to play catchup up until the last closing seconds of the second half in which they managed to finally tie the game in regulation play 47-47 both teams played hard during this time showcasing their strong defenses.

In the 3 minute overtime period the lead flipped back and forth twice until Suga Show found one last burst within them to take and secure a lead with nearly a minute left in overtime play.

Top scorers for Suga Show in its first game of the City of Laredo’s Division A Winter League were Anthony Merino who scored 14 points with 5 rebounds, Jerry Garcia who finished his night with 13 points and 10 rebounds, Josue Casarez who scored 10 points with 3 rebounds, Devin Stallings puts in 8 with 10 rebounds, while Leonardo Campos adds 4 points of his own and Joshwa Palacios adds 2 points to the score both Campos and Palacios were making their Suga Show debut last night as new team members.

This is the first time in 3 seasons that Suga Show starts off with a win they had lost the first game of the previous two seasons while still managing to finish with winning records and playoff appearances in those two seasons. Last night’s win also brings to an end a four-game losing streak that went back to the last two games of the season including two devastating playoff losses.

Last night’s game against Dos Marias was also the second time in two meetings that the game ended in overtime with Suga winning both games coming back from behind in regulation play in both games in the final seconds to force the game into overtime.
Suga Show’s next game will be on December 5th against EZ Money who has started their season in the A Division with a win this week.

EZ Money is led by Chuy Treviño whom was a former member of Suga Show and a former team member of the legendary Tune Squad who won the championship in the C Division in last year’s City of Laredo Summer League.

The 2023 Suga Show roster for this winter season includes Anthony Merino, Julian Gonzalez, Tony Garza, Devin Stallings, Billy Rodd, Josue Casarez, Austin Estevis, Sergio Castillo, Eddie Jaime, Leonardo Campos, Adrian Gaytan, Jaime Perez, Albert Moncivais, Jerry Garcia, Joshwa Palacios and Chuy Cisneros.
